Calling all Xbox Live® gamers! You're about to experience a whole new level in entertainment. Yes, we're talking about the launch of Xbox 360™, but we're also talking about the brand new—and free—Xbox Live Diamond Card, an unprecedented merger of your entertainment activities, online and off. Never heard of it? Well, here's what you're in for:


Your own card: Did you sign up for a digital gamer card on Xbox.com? Of course you did. Now, how about a real, live, flash-it-to-your-friends card personalized with your gamertag? Ask no more! The Xbox Live Diamond Card is here.

That's not all: The card does much more. Xbox Live has partnered with your favorite stores, restaurants, and other retailers across the country for discounts and promotions exclusively for Xbox Live Diamond Card program members.*

It gets even better: Xbox Live isn't going to sit still, either. We'll continue to bring you new partners and more opportunities to use your Diamond Card.

The best part: The Xbox Live Diamond Card is free! It's our big thank you to all our loyal Xbox Live subscribers.

The Details

Xbox Live 12-month subscribers on the original Xbox® and Xbox Live Gold 12-month subscribers on Xbox 360 who opt in for Xbox communications can sign up now for the program—you'll get your cards shortly after the '05 holiday season.


Xbox Live Diamond Card memberships are good for one year from the date of issue, and you'll get a new card every year as long as you remain an Xbox Live 12-month subscriber (on Xbox or Xbox 360) and opt in for Xbox communications.**


Who's partnering with Xbox Live to bring you special perks card offers? How about Ticketmaster, Cambridge Soundworks, Timberland, Dish Network, and hundreds more? Thought that would get your attention.
